Begin at the heart of the city, in Piazza Navona, where Fontana dei Quattro Fiumi (Fountain of the Four Rivers) bursts to life in a theatrical display of water, stone, and symbolism. Each figure writhes with energy, their forms frozen mid-motion, as if captured in a divine breath.
Just steps away, enter the tranquil interior of Sant’Andrea al Quirinale, a jewel-box church Bernini considered one of his most perfect works. With its elliptical design and subtle manipulation of space, it’s a quiet masterpiece of harmony and grace—a sacred geometry wrapped in gold and marble!
No tour of Bernini would be complete without witnessing one of his most iconic and stirring works: The Ecstasy of Saint Teresa, tucked within the Cornaro Chapel of Santa Maria della Vittoria. Here, stone becomes spirit. The saint, overcome in divine rapture, is caught mid-swoon beneath a burst of golden rays, while onlookers carved in side niches seem to gasp in eternal awe.
This is Bernini at his most daring, blurring the line between sculpture and stage, between reality and revelation.
Continue to St. Peter’s Basilica, where Bernini’s grand vision helped shape the spiritual heart of Christendom. Stand beneath the vast bronze baldachin, his monumental canopy that soars above the high altar, twisting like vines in a sacred dance. In the piazza outside, his colonnades embrace pilgrims and visitors alike, forming open arms of stone that welcome the world into the Church.
Nearby, admire the Chair of Saint Peter, a fusion of architecture, sculpture, and stained glass that seems to float above the apse—heaven touching earth through Bernini’s imagination.
